What Causes Red Spot On Roof Of Mouth And Blood In Mucus?

I have a red spot on the roof of my mouth with a dull white center. Every few days it fills up with fluid and then becomes painful and pops. It then fills up again over 2-3 days. My mouth also has a horrible tinny taste in my mouth. I think I could potentially have a sinus infection as I also have blood in my mucus.

The type of red spot you are mentioning, it looks that it is a sinus opening which has occurred because of tooth infection or gum infection.
Actually when an upper tooth is infected there is formation of abscess and in chronic conditions it drains from the palate (roof) , that is why you are feeling

It could possibly a mucocele or ranula which is due to salivary gland obstruction. It fills with mucus and wen it rupture mucous comes in your mouth leading to bad taste. Its basically a false cyst some time it fills with blood. For confirmatory diagnosis you can go for biopsy.it has recurrence.
